Output 31a3fab94ce4d70a77f96347dbe744a787b8f19d960b63038a53988251807aa1:4

value
100247571
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c74c56eb451b0312ed6a489e6fd4deeb26c0522a OP_EQUAL
address
3Kroqt59u9pW3b7YwkYwH2eEzRjkvyHwWU
transaction
31a3fab94ce4d70a77f96347dbe744a787b8f19d960b63038a53988251807aa1
spent
true